KR62 ZBN is a 2012 Citroen DS5 in Blue with a 1,997c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 18 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 66.7%.

Across all 2012 Citroen DS5 models, the average MOT pass rate is 76.3% with a typical mileage of 75,701 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Citroen DS5 f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 640 recorded failures. If you're considering buying KR62 ZBN,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Citroen DS5 typically stays on UK roads for around 14 years. At 14 years old, this Citroen DS5 is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
